Berea is a southwest Cuyahoga County suburb of roughly 19,000 organized around the "Berea Triangle" — the historic downtown wedge formed by Front Street, Bagley Road, and the railroad. Two major institutions anchor the city: Baldwin Wallace University, with roughly 3,500 students concentrated around the Bagley and Front Street campus core, and the Cleveland Browns training facility, which generates concentrated traffic during summer training camp. The Cleveland Metroparks (Mill Stream Run, Rocky River Reservation, and Bonnie Park) wrap the city''s western and southern edges with deep-valley parkway roads. Historic Berea Sandstone quarries shape the topography under it all.
Four corridors carry the heaviest traffic. I-71 runs east-west along the city''s southern edge as the spine into downtown Cleveland — Exit 235 at Bagley Road is a documented crash-exposure point. The I-480 / SR-237 "Berea Freeway" is the direct connector to Cleveland Hopkins International Airport immediately northeast, carrying heavy commercial, rental-car, and rideshare traffic. Bagley Road runs east-west through the Berea Triangle past Baldwin Wallace with dense signalized intersections and school-zone overlap. Front Street and Rocky River Drive (SR-237) run north-south, connecting Bagley to the airport via the Berea Freeway.
Civil personal-injury claims arising out of a Berea crash that exceed $15,000 are filed in the Cuyahoga County Court of Common Pleas at the Justice Center in downtown Cleveland. Most serious-injury cases clear that $15,000 threshold and belong in Common Pleas, not the municipal court. Berea Municipal Court at 11 Berea Commons — the city''s home court — handles traffic citations and misdemeanors with civil jurisdiction capped at $15,000; it serves Berea, Brook Park, Middleburg Heights, Olmsted Falls, Olmsted Township, Strongsville, and the Cleveland Metroparks. Ohio''s statute of limitations is two years (R.C. § 2305.10).

Local Roads
Accident corridors in Berea.
I-71
East-west spine to downtown Cleveland along the city''s southern edge — Exit 235 at Bagley Road is a documented crash-exposure point where commuter merges meet the surface road network.
I-480 / SR-237 (Berea Freeway) to Cleveland Hopkins
Direct connector to Cleveland Hopkins International Airport immediately northeast — heavy commercial, rental-car, and rideshare traffic produces constant ramp-merge and high-speed lane-change crashes.
Bagley Road
East-west through the Berea Triangle past Baldwin Wallace University — dense signalized intersections, school-zone exposure during academic year, and pedestrian-strike risk in the campus core.
Front Street / Rocky River Drive (SR-237)
North-south spine connecting Bagley Road to the airport via the Berea Freeway — commuter and airport-bound flow overlap with downtown Berea retail and pedestrian traffic.
